Old Town Ice Cream Co, nestled on W Irlo Bronson Memorial Hwy in Kissimmee, is a charming ice cream shop that masterfully blends nostalgia with quality. Walking inside, you immediately sense the old-time decor, evoking memories of classic American soda fountains, which sets a warm and inviting tone before even tasting a single scoop.
The menu at Old Town Ice Cream Co is delightfully diverse. Their hard ice cream selection—boasting around 16 to 20 flavors—offers everything from fruity to decadent, with standouts like the Very Berry Lemonade, Tropical Paradise, and Sunset Dream showcasing vibrant, refreshing profiles that are perfect for cooling down under Florida’s sun. These frozen house favorites are carefully crafted, with each bite delivering rich texture and balanced sweetness that feels both homemade and indulgent.
One notable highlight is their creative integration of classic and contemporary flavors: the Pina Colada, Corona, and Margarita selections add an adult twist, reflecting a playful nod to tropical cocktails, all served as ice cream or slushies, which perfectly complement the warm Kissimmee vibe. Additionally, the Banana Split pays homage to traditional ice cream parlor staples, skillfully presented and generously portioned.
The food offerings go beyond typical ice cream fare, which enriches the overall experience. Items like Garlic Knots, the Cheeseburger Combo, and Steak Sandwich provide savory counterpoints that satisfy more substantial cravings. This variety makes Old Town Ice Cream Co not just a dessert stop but a complete casual dining destination.
Drinks such as the Classic Soda, including the nostalgic A&W Root Beer—highlighted by customer Linda Wozniak—blend perfectly with the ice cream to round out the experience. The presence of hot chocolate and bottled water ensures there is something for every palate and weather condition, making this spot versatile.
Customer reviews reflect a community rekindling affection for this establishment, with remarks about its resurgence and fond memories of it being a “black market mineral shop”—a curious nugget that hints at its unique past. Though tucked inside an A&W restaurant, which Mark Genovese notes can make it a bit elusive, the experience rewards those who seek it out.
